Transaction 88dc9933a1f3905640bf7016650781387c0aadd22e9b437470d7025115ad30ba

1 Input
2 Outputs
  • 88dc9933a1f3905640bf7016650781387c0aadd22e9b437470d7025115ad30ba:0
  • value  25141876
    address  1583hTYRwDqfCuG1xSAUVfsCSTwknE1AhM
  • 88dc9933a1f3905640bf7016650781387c0aadd22e9b437470d7025115ad30ba:1
  • value  6653109
    address  1BYQafqT3pJaf34tWHzM1cB3RrTWwDShT8